[0003] However, the current samples are generally marked with a marker pen number, and the anti-counterfeiting of the test piece is insufficient, and it is easy to be considered as an exchange, which affects the accuracy of the test results and ultimately affects the safety of the building; the transportation process is generally stacked with multiple samples. Transportation after the vehicle, the transportation process is easy to cause wear and tear on the sample, and the label cannot be seen clearly, which affects the corresponding test; at the same time, the sample after transportation to the test field should be measured advancedly, and the staff usually use a tape measure or ruler to measure To measure and reject unqualified samples, the workload is heavy, the work efficiency is low, human errors are prone to occur, and the accuracy of the samples is affected
Therefore, there is an urgent need for a device that can simultaneously realize anti-counterfeiting, measurement, rejection of unqualified samples, and boxing to improve work efficiency, reduce labor intensity, and prevent inaccurate tests caused by the replacement of samples.

Abstract

The invention discloses a concrete test block anti-counterfeiting management and control system which comprises a conveying assembly used for conveying concrete test pieces. An anti-counterfeiting module is arranged in the concrete test piece; the conveying assembly comprises a first conveying belt and a second conveying belt which communicate with each other. The second conveying belt communicates with an automatic boxing assembly. A restraining assembly is arranged on the first conveying belt; an anti-fake spraying and carving part and a screening part are sequentially arranged on the first conveying belt in the conveying direction, the anti-fake spraying and carving part is used for spraying and carving anti-fake marks on the surfaces of the concrete test pieces, and the screening part is used for screening out unqualified concrete test pieces. The device is simple in mechanism, high in automation degree, high in working efficiency, low in labor intensity and low in loss, can fully automatically complete a series of procedures such as measurement, anti-counterfeiting, screening of unqualified test pieces and automatic boxing of the concrete test pieces, can also effectively improve the anti-counterfeiting property of the concrete test pieces, prevents inaccurate test results caused by manual replacement of the concrete test pieces, and improves the product quality. And the safety of the building is improved, and the service life is prolonged.

Description

technical field [0001] The invention relates to the technical field of automated production lines, in particular to an anti-counterfeiting control system and method for concrete test blocks. Background technique [0002] Concrete is currently the most widely used civil engineering material, and its physical and mechanical properties are very important, especially for those buildings with concrete as the main material. The mechanical properties of concrete directly affect the safety of these buildings. The physical and mechanical properties of concrete often need to be tested through multiple sets of concrete test blocks. At present, the concrete test blocks are generally poured according to the required size, and then transported by the construction personnel to the testing unit for testing.
